MINI CORN MUFFINS WITH SPICY CHEDDAR FILLING



Mini Corn Muffins with Spicy Cheddar Filling image

I'm an Iowa gardener and I like to feature sweet corn in my recipes. These cute, easy-to-eat bites are a fun change from the usual appetizers. -Margaret Blair, Lorimor, Iowa

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ers

Time 55m

Yield 4 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 15

1-1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1 cup cornmeal
2 teaspoons sugar
3/4 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 large egg, room temperature
3/4 cup 2% milk
1/4 cup canola oil
1 can (14-3/4 ounces) cream-style corn
FILLING:
2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
1 can (4 ounces) chopped green chiles
1/4 cup diced pimientos
1 teaspoon chili powder
1/4 teaspoon hot pepper sauce

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400°. In a large bowl, whisk the first 5 ingredients. In another bowl, whisk egg, milk and oil until blended. Add to flour mixture; stir just until moistened. Fold in corn., Fill greased mini muffin cups three-fourths full. Bake 15-18 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ool 5 minutes before removing from pans to wire racks. Reduce oven setting to 350°., Meanwhile, in a large bowl, combine filling ingredients. Using a small melon baller, scoop out the center of each muffin; spoon a rounded teaspoon of filling into the center. Bake 10-12 minutes or until cheese is melted.

SPICY CORNBREAD MINI-MUFFINS



Spicy Cornbread Mini-Muffins image

These are perfect for making 3 dozen mini muffins to take to a potluck. Basting the muffin tin with melted butter and dusting with cornmeal are an essential step to getting a marvelous crispy exterior to the muffins. To add more kick, do not seed the jalapenos and add an extra one.

Provided by AnniecatMT

Categories     Bread     Quick Bread Recipes     Muffin Recipes     Savory Muffin Recipes

Time 40m

Yield 36

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 cup all-purpose flour
1 cup yellow cornmeal
¼ cup white sugar
4 teaspoons baking powder
½ te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 ½ cups finely shredded Cheddar cheese
1 cup milk
2 eggs
¼ cup vegetable oil
3 canned jalapeno peppers - stems and seeds removed and peppers finely diced
¼ teaspoon vanilla extract
1 tablespoon butter, melted - divided
3 tablespoons yellow cornmeal, or as needed - divided

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C).
  • Whisk flour, 1 cup cornmeal, sugar, baking powder, salt, and garlic powder together in a bowl. Mix Cheddar cheese into dry ingredients until coated.
  • Beat milk, eggs, vegetable oil, jalapeno peppers, and vanilla extract together in a separate bowl until well mixed. Make a well in the Cheddar cheese mixture and pour egg mixture into the well; stir just until combined. Batter should be slightly lumpy.
  • Brush 18 mini muffin cups with melted butter; spoon about 1 teaspoon cornmeal into each mini muffin cup, tilt pan to coat muffin cups with cornmeal, and tap out the excess. Spoon batter into each muffin cup to about 2/3 full.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until lightly browned, 11 to 12 minutes. Allow to cool 5 minutes in the pans before removing to finish cooling.

CHEDDAR CORN MUFFINS



Cheddar Corn Muffins image

I found this recipe in a cookbook called. Quick Vegetarian Pleasures. Makes 12 muffins. "These are light and moist, with a mild but irresistible cheese accent. They are equally good served for breakfast or with chili. If you want a more traditional corn muffin, just leave out the cheese."

Provided by AustinMama

Categories     Quick Breads

Time 27m

Yield 12 muffins, 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 cup unbleached flour
1 cup cornmeal (I like to use coarser polenta)
1 tablespo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 cup sugar
1 large egg
1 cup milk
4 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
1 1/4 cups grated sharp cheddar cheese

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ees.
  • Butter the insides and the top of a regular muffin pan (1/3 cup).
  • In large bowl thoroughly combine the flour, cornmeal, baking powder, salt and sugar.
  • In medium bowl, beat the egg.
  • Beat in the milk and the melted butter.
  • Combine with the dry ingredients until just evenly moistened.
  • Do not overmix.
  • Stir in 1 cup of cheese.
  • Immediately spoon the batter into the muffin pan.
  • Evenly sprinkle the remaining cheese on top of the muffins.
  • Bake 17 minutes or until a knife inserted in the center of the muffin comes out clean.
  • Best served warm.

SPICY CORNBREAD MUFFINS



Spicy Cornbread Muffins image

Provided by Patrick and Gina Neely : Food Network

Categories     side-dish

Time 30m

Yield 12 muffins

Number Of Ingredients 15

Nonstick spray
1/2 cup (1 stick) butter, divided
1/2 onion, finely chopped
1 small red Fresno chile pepper, seeded and finely chopped
1 medium poblano pepper, seeded and finely chopped
Salt
1/2 cup frozen corn, thawed
1 cup all-purpose flour
1 cup yellow cornmeal
2 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on salt
1 cup buttermilk
3 large eggs
1 cup shredded Cheddar

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F. Spray a 12 cup muffin pan with nonstick spray.
  • In a medium saute pan, over medium heat, add 2 tablespoons butter. Once the butter has melted add the onions and the peppers and saute until soft, about 4 minutes. Season with salt, to taste. Stir in the corn and cook until heated through. Set aside to cool.
  • Melt the remanding butter in a small pan over low heat and once melted, remove from the heat.
  • In a large bowl, combine the flour, cornmeal, baking powder, baking soda and salt.
  • In another large bowl, add the buttermilk and the eggs. Whisk lightly until combined. Using the well method, add the liquid ingredients to the dry ingredients and fold together until combined. Add the sauteed vegetables with the melted butter and the shredded cheese and continue to fold. The batter will be very thick.
  • Using a 1/2 cup measure, evenly scoop the batter into the muffin tin. Bake for 10 minutes. Remove from the oven and let cool for 10 minutes on a wire rack before serving.

SPICY ROASTED RED PEPPER CORN MUFFINS



Spicy Roasted Red Pepper Corn Muffins image

Categories     Bread     Side     Bake     Quick & Easy     Cheddar     Cornmeal     Bell Pepper     Fall     Jalapeño     Gourmet     Sugar Conscious     Kidney Friendly     Vegetarian     Pescatarian     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     Kosher

Yield Makes 12 muffins

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 1/4 cups yellow cornmeal
1/2 cup all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on sugar
1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on salt
1 cup grated extra-sharp Cheddar cheese (about 4 ounces)
3/4 cup buttermilk
1 large egg
1/2 stick (1/4 cup) unsalted butter, melted and cooled
2 tablespoons minced seeded pickled jalapeño chilies (wear rubber gloves)
a 7-ounce jar roasted red peppers, drained, rinsed, patted very dry between paper towels, and chopped fine

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 425°F. and butter twelve 1/3-cup muffin tins.
  • In a bowl whisk together cornmeal, flour,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, salt, and Cheddar. In a small bowl whisk together buttermilk, egg, butter, and chilies. Add buttermilk mixture to cornmeal mixture, stirring until just combined, and stir in roasted peppers (do not overmix).
  • Divide batter evenly among muffin tins and bake in middle of oven 15 to 20 minutes, or until golden and a tester comes out clean.

CORNBREAD MUFFINS WITH CHEDDAR CHEESE



Cornbread Muffins with Cheddar Cheese image

This complements any vegetarian or meat meal, breakfast, lunch, or dinner. It's a keeper!

Provided by Cinderella

Categories     Bread     Quick Bread Recipes     Muffin Recipes     Savory Muffin Recipes

Time 35m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 cup milk
½ cup sour cream
¼ cup butter, melted
1 egg, lightly beaten
1 cup all-purpose flour
1 cup cornmeal
1 cup chopped whole kernel corn
2 tablespoons white sugar
½ teaspoon baking powder
½ teaspoon baking soda
½ teaspoon salt
½ cup shredded Cheddar cheese

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Grease 12 muffin cups or line with paper muffin liners.
  • Beat milk, sour cream, butter, and egg together in a large mixing bowl until smooth; add flour, cornmeal, chopped corn,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. Whisk mixture until dry ingredients are just moistened; fold Cheddar cheese into the batter. Divide batter between 12 muffin cups.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ean, 15 to 18 minutes. Cool in the pans for 10 minutes before removing to cool completely on a wire rack.

CHEDDAR CHEESE & CORN MUFFINS



Cheddar Cheese & Corn Muffins image

These delicious cheesy corn muffins make a perfect healthy treat for children. Served warm straight from the oven they contain a scrummy chunk of melted cheese in the middle.

Provided by isobelstorm

Time 25m

Yield Makes Muffins

Number Of Ingredients 13

300g self-raising flour (white or wholemeal)
2 tsp baking powder
Pinch of salt
1tsp sugar
75g Yeo Valley Organic Mature cheddar cheese, grated
50g Yeo Valley Organic Mature cheddar cheese, cut into 12 small chunks
75g canned sweetcorn, drained
60g Yeo Valley Organic Butter
1 tsp English mustard
150g Yeo Valley Organic Greek yogurt
175ml Yeo Valley Organic milk
1 egg
1tbsp chopped fresh chives

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 200C/gas mark 6.
  • Mix together the self-raising flour, baking powder, salt, sugar, grated cheese and sweetcorn in a bowl.
  • Melt the butter then mix in the mustard, yogurt, milk, egg and chives. Pour the cheese mixture into the flour and mix briefly to combine. Spoon a small amount of the batter into lightly greased muffin tins. Place a piece of cheese in the centre of each muffin then top with the remaining batter.
  • Bake in the oven and bake for 20-25 minutes until golden. Remove and place on a wire rack. Serve warm.
